AP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5界面做成app

在将h5界面转化为app之前,我们需要了解什么是h5。h5是一种基于HTML、CSS和JavaScript等Web语言的Web技术集合,主要用于在移动设备和桌面浏览器上,开发互联网和移动应用程序界面。h5作为一种跨平台技术,具有适应性强、开发成本低、易于维护、易于扩展等优点,因此被广泛应用于移动应用和Web开发。

将h5转化为app通常有两种方式:WebView和Hybrid。

WebView是指利用Native应用的Webview组件来加载h5页面,实现将h5页面打包成类似应用的效果。WebView类似于浏览器内核,可以直接访问h5页面。在开发过程中,我们需要先用h5开发好网页,然后用Android Studio或Xcode等开发平台,将h5页面作为应用的主页面,同时进行一些相关配置后即可打包成app。

Hybrid是指将Native应用与h5应用进行混合开发,将Native的能力和h5的灵活性结合在一起。通常先开发一个Native的壳子,然后在其中嵌入h5页面和Native组件,实现Native与h5混合开发的效果。Hybrid开发可以利用Native的一些硬件性能和系统级别的API,同时又可以利用h5的灵活性实现更多复杂的交互效果。

无论是WebView还是Hybrid,都需要在开发过程中使用一些工具来辅助开发,例如ionic、React Native等框架可以帮助我们开发Native应用时嵌入h5页面,同时提供一些常用的UI组件和功能组件。接下来我们来介绍具体的实现过程:

1. 开发h5页面

在进行h5页面开发时,需要考虑在移动设备上的适配性和显示效果。可以使用rem布局或者flex布局进行适配,在实现过程中尽量使用浏览器支持的标准化Web技术。

2. 嵌入WebView或Hybrid开发

通过WebView或混合开发的方式,将h5页面嵌入到Native应用中。对于WebView,可以通过Android System或Xcode直接调用WebView的相关组件,将h5页面作为应用的主要页面。而对于Hybrid开发,需要在Native应用壳中添加一些h5组件和JavaScript桥接,同时在壳中响应与h5交互事件。

3. 本地化存储

在开发过程中需要注意本地化存储。为了提高用户体验,开发者应该尽量将页面内容和数据缓存在本地,从而提高页面加载速度和易用性。

4. 优化应用效率

在开发过程中,需要对应用程序进行优化,解决应用卡顿、CPU占用过高、电量消耗等问题。可以通过性能监测、调试等方式,不断优化应用程序。

总的来说,将h5界面转化成app,需要具备涉及到的技能和工具,且需要对Web开发、Native开发、用户体验和用户需求等有深度的了解,只有这样,才能开发出适合用户需求,且能够较好满足用户需求的app。


相关知识:
制作h5页面工具app
H5页面(HTML5页面)是一种基于HTML5技术和Web标准开发的网页应用程序,而制作H5页面的工具则是一种能够帮助开发者快速创建H5页面的软件或应用程序。目前市面上有很多制作H5页面的工具,包括在线平台、桌面软件和移动应用程序等。以下将介绍其中一款基于
2023-05-26
梧州h5开发app
在移动互联网时代,应用开发成为了一项非常热门的技术。为了让用户更加方便的使用应用程序,app出现了。但是,为了方便用户,许多应用都需要下载安装,这使得应用的使用更加繁琐。为了解决这个问题,越来越多的开发者选择采用H5开发app的方式来实现应用程序的开发。一
2023-05-26
那些app是h5开发的
H5开发是一种流行的跨平台开发方式,它可以同时适用于iOS和Android操作系统,而且也不需要安装任何应用程序,只需要在浏览器中访问网页,就可以体验各种应用。以下是一些流行的使用H5技术开发的应用程序。1. 微信微信是一个十分流行的社交媒体平台,同时也是
2023-05-26
目前免费的h5制作app
最近,随着移动互联网的发展,H5制作App的需求也越来越大。与此同时,也有不少免费的H5制作App平台应运而生。本文将介绍目前比较受欢迎的免费H5制作App平台及其原理。1. 靠谱App:靠谱App是一款可以轻松制作H5 App的工具。不需要编程技能,只需
2023-05-26
免费h5页面制作软件app
近年来,随着互联网技术和移动设备的发展,H5页面逐渐成为互联网应用开发的重要基础。而为了更好地满足市场需求,一些厂商推出了免费的H5页面制作软件,方便用户快速制作H5页面。下面本文将为大家介绍几款免费的H5页面制作软件。1. MagicHTMLMagicH
2023-05-26
h5做app网页
随着移动互联网的发展,越来越多的网站选择去做一个适配移动端的APP。而如今,通过H5技术来做APP已经成为了一种非常流行的解决方案,本文就为您详细介绍一下H5做APP网页的原理和具体实现方法。一、原理介绍H5(HTML5)是HTML最新版本,它是一种新兴的
2023-05-25
h5页面如何封装app
随着移动互联网的飞速发展,越来越多的企业和个人开始重视在移动端应用上的投入和开发,而对于有些企业或个人,没有足够的资金或技术实力去开发原生应用,那么如何通过现有的网页技术开发出一款类似原生应用的APP呢?这里就要介绍一种基于H5页面封装app的方案。一、什
2023-05-25
h5项目一键封装app
随着移动互联网的普及,web应用和移动应用的融合也越来越紧密。开发人员需要将Web应用封装成移动应用让用户下载安装使用。现在市面上有一种技术,即H5项目一键封装APP。本篇文章将详细介绍H5项目一键封装APP的原理和实现。一、H5项目一键封装APP的原理H
2023-05-25
h5可以开发移动app吗
HTML5技术标准自从2014年正式推出以来,就已经引起了全球互联网业的广泛关注与热议,并被誉为当时互联网业的一项重大进步。而其逐渐成熟的混合应用开发方案正逐渐成为了移动应用开发领域的一大亮点。H5技术标准的推出与HTML语言相关,因此我们潜意识地认为这项
2023-05-25
h5开发版app
H5开发版APP是一种基于HTML5技术的轻量级APP,同时具有与原生APP相当的用户体验和功能。它通过移动端的浏览器来访问网站,具有无需下载、多平台支持、快速上线和易于维护等优势。下面将详细介绍H5开发版APP的原理和实现方法。一、原理H5开发版APP基
2023-05-25
h5打包app怎么微信登录
HTML5 打包 APP 时,为了方便用户登录,经常会使用微信登录功能。微信登录是基于微信开放平台的网站应用开发和移动应用开发,通过微信认证进行用户身份识别和获取用户信息,实现用户一次授权,多端使用的登录方式。下面将详细介绍如何在 H5 打包 APP 中使
2023-05-25
app生成h5
近年来,移动应用程序的普及使得用户对客户端应用的需求迅速增长,但是,开发人员需要为不同平台编写多个应用程序,这增加了他们的工作负担并消耗了大量资源。 换句话说,开发人员需要为多个操作系统编写不同版本的应用程序,这使得这个进程显得十分繁琐。因此,现在,一些软
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3